    depends how hardcore you want to get with your cutting diet. fruits, berries especially are high in sugars, same goes for pinapple and bananas. if you can manage cut out all fruit to really force your body to burn fat, i've tried it and i find it almost impossible to do. cutting out refined sugars and carbs is easy comparing it to cutting out fruit. try to keep the fruit eating with your pwo shake.

    Bryan, Its normal to feel this way after what you have now gone through for 14 weeks. You already know that you can mix in some fun times with your buds as long as the majority of your time is spent focused on your diet. There are times during this where you probably ask yourself "why am I continuing this when I already finished my twelve week program?". Yes, getting your abs to show is a good reason to continue, but you are also laying down the foundation for the rest of your 20's 30's and even your 40's. (i realize you are 19 right now). While you are tired of doing this cutting stuff, remember that cutting is popular during the summer. Fall is the time to start thinking about bulking and then doing your bulking cycle through the winter months. This shouldn't be a battle between wanting to hang with friends and wanting to stay focused on your body. You can do both if you just dont overdue the bad stuff.
